Digital River World Payments partners Acculynk for PaySecure payment method

Wednesday 25 April 2012 11:51 CET | News

Digital River World Payments, a part of the Digital River family of companies, has inked an agreement with online PIN-debit technology provider Acculynk to offer online merchants the latter’s PaySecure payment method for internet PIN debit.

Following the agreement, online merchants using the Digital River World Payments or Global Commerce enterprise solutions will now have access to  Acculynks PaySecure. The payment method enbales customers to pay for online purchases with a PIN debit card.

Via PaySecure, online shoppers enter their PIN on a virtual PIN-pad pop-up during the checkout process on the merchants commerce website. PaySecure is designed to provide an extra layer of security for debit card transactions, helping reduce fraud and charge-backs for merchants.

PaySecure is currently enabled on over 3,000 merchant websites. Acculynk has partnerships with ten EFT networks to process PaySecure transactions and with six payment processors and is certified with PULSE, First Data and Master Card, among other industry companies.

Nowadays, there are more than 82 million PIN-only debit card holders in the US, Puerto Rico and the Caribbean.
